Continental Takes Manufacturing to a New Level

Continental AG is expanding its Romanian site in Timisoara, the third time since its opening in 2006. Essentially, the expanded mega factory, which opened in November, will produce innovative User Experience solutions such as displays at the enlarged site.

Most importantly, the new investment will continue to make the factory as one of the company’s flagship production sites in promoting advanced automation and digital production technologies.

With an investment of around €40 million, the new site will grow the production area by over 7,000 to 18,000sq.m, increasing to more than 60 percent of space. However, establishing a mega factory not only marks an increase in area, but above all focuses on the technological innovation of production.

With the third expansion since 2006, the Continental plant in Timisoara, Romania, has become a megafactory.

Bundles Capacities, Competencies

Recently, Continental has won additional major orders worth more than €2 billion from global vehicle manufacturers for its large display solutions. This brings the awarded lifetime sales for Continental display solutions with SOP after 2022 to over €7 billion.

With the expansion, Continental is bundling production capacities and competencies at a selected central location. With this mega factory strategy, the technology company continues to drive forward the paradigm shift in production of automotive user experience technologies and creates great advantages, both economically and technologically.

Cutting edge technology for production of display solutions: Continental’s mega factory in Timisoara uses artificial intelligence for final quality tests.

Especially, the extremely complex manufacturing of large display solutions such as C-Shape, L-Shape or Pillar-to-Pillar Displays requires bundled production volumes to increase in quality and speed.

Highly Automated, Digitally Connected, Sustainable Facility

The Continental Automotive plant in Timisoara has been a pioneer in terms of digitally connected production technologies for many years. In fact, it has always been a benchmark factory for Industry 4.0. By focusing on people, standardization, automation and digitalization, the expanded plant in Timisoara covers all the crucial topics of future mobility.

Furthermore, future-proofs the company’s display production worldwide. Especially, the automation of simple tasks leads to a higher production speed while at the same time standardization ensures higher quality.

The trend toward large displays continues unabated, calling for large high-tech manufacturing facilities.

In combination with the focus on digitalization and people the expansion creates competitive advantages in the production of complex display solutions. Virtual Reality line planning, simulation and optimization will enable Continental to produce large display solutions at top speed with high quality and low invests.

Augmented Reality plays key role for maintenance and product development leading to cost savings and higher quality. Meanwhile, artificial intelligence and robotics support the employees.

To illustrate, the electronic components factory in Timisoara produces more than 17 million products annually. These include for example airbag control units, electronic parking brakes, control units for air suspension. In addition, damping and vertical stabilization, power steering control units, as well as display solutions and head-up displays.
